Given that no specific components have been flagged in the MOT record, buyer-side inspection must concentrate on the areas most prone to wear or failure on a high-mileage American pickup of this vintage. On a road test, listen for any clonking or knocking from the front suspension over uneven surfaces, particularly at low speed, which would suggest worn ball joints, track rod ends, or anti-roll bar bushes, none of which may yet have deteriorated to MOT failure threshold but could be approaching advisory level. Check for uneven tyre wear across both axles, as misaligned geometry from worn components is common. Feel for any pulling to one side under braking, which can indicate a binding caliper or a warped front disc, both plausible at this mileage despite the clean test record. The braking system warrants particular attention given the vehicle's age and the likelihood that original brake pipes and flexible hoses remain in service. Although no corrosion advisories have been recorded, undersides of vehicles from this era frequently exhibit surface rust on brake pipes, particularly along the chassis rails and rear axle lines, which can advance between tests. Inspect the exhaust system visually for any signs of corrosion at the joints and mounting points, as original mild-steel systems rarely survive this long without replacement. Under the bonnet, check for signs of oil misting or weeping from the valve cover gaskets, oil pan, and rear main seal, all common on high-mileage V8 engines, and verify that transmission fluid is at the correct level and not discoloured.
